Polymeric ruthenium precursor as a photoactivated antimicrobial agent

Ruthenium coordination compounds have demonstrated a promising anticancer and antibacterial activity, but their poor water solubility low stability under physiological conditions may limit therapeutic applications. Physical encapsulation or covalent conjugation with polymers overcome these drawbacks, generally involve multistep reactions purification processes. In this work, the activity of polymeric precursor dicarbonyldichlororuthenium (II) [Ru(CO)2Cl2]n has been studied against Escherichia coli Staphylococcus aureus. This Ru-carbonyl shows minimum inhibitory concentration at nanogram per millilitre, which renders it novel antimicrobial polymer without any organic ligands.
